Also, is this right? sqrt should become an ISD node, which at least on some 
platforms, gets directly lowered.

Generally, I'm a bit concerned here that we really need target feedback to make 
this decision properly. These are fine defaults, but we don't want to prevent 
the intended direct lowering (which is the whole point of the builtins anyway).

But, hey, Clang can use TTI too :-) [Unfortunately, I'm not kidding really].
